Microcanonical solution of lattice models with long range interactions

Julien Barre

Published 2001-10-11Version 1

We present a general method to obtain the microcanonical solution of lattice models with long range interactions. As an example, we apply it to the long range Ising chain, focusing on the role of boundary conditions.
